Admixtures in Concrete : Perks & Considerations
Supplemental materials are widely incorporated into concrete to alter their characteristics and boost functionality . These materials, which can be synthetic , offer a range of benefits , including increased plasticity , reduced moisture content, accelerated or postponed hardening times, and superior defense against freeze-thaw damage. However, thorough evaluation is crucial when specifying admixtures; reactions with different materials can lead to negative effects, and excessive usage may weaken the overall stability of the concrete . Correct dosage and thorough incorporation are vital for realizing the intended results.
